Significant Investment in Farm Mechanization
The Punjab government is investing more than 60 billion rupees to introduce 20,000 new tractors in the entire province. This ambitious plan includes:
- Subsidized Tractors: 10,000 tractors (50-65 horse power) will be for the sale with huge 70% subsidy up to a limit of Rs. 1 million. This makes it much more affordable for the average farmer to have modern machinery.
- High-Powered Tractors: Yet another 10,000 tractors (with engine power of 75-125hp) will be subsidized to the tune of 50%, with a limit of PKR 1 million, for bigger farm requirements.
- Special Facilities for Wheat Farmers: In view of the importance of growing wheat, 1,000 tractors are being offered absolutely for nothing to wheat cultivators owning 25 to 50 acres of land.
Eligibility and Application Process
There are certain eligibility requirements for farmers who want to qualify for this program:
- Domicile: Candidates should be domiciled in Punjab.
- Age: You should be between 21 and 65 years of age.
- Size of holding: Land owned should be between 1 and 50 acres, with special conditions for the wheat farmer.
- ID: CNIC is a must.
- Kissan Card: You must have a Kissan card as well.
The application process is simplified for ease of use. Farmers can register themselves either online on the official portal at gts. punjab. gov.pk or by visiting agriculture offices in their respective areas. Beneficiaries will be selected openly through an electronic ballot, which is the only fair way to do so.
Unlocking Benefits and Addressing Challenges
There are many reasons this program is beneficial. Farmers will benefit in terms of huge cost savings, improvement in farm productivity through advanced mechanization, and access to hassle free financing, with a 20% down payment and balance to be paid through installments as convenient to the farmers. The scheme also dovetails well with other agri-subsidies, including the Kissan Card and different input subsidies, providing an umbrella support mechanism for farmers.

But as with any massive program, there can be complications. There may be challenges for some farmers to meet documentation requirements, and the digital divide in rural areas could present an obstacle to online applications. Moreover, as there are few tractors available and higher expected competition, strict monitoring is essential to ensure the transparency of the selection process.
